Section 18-331 - Collection of Data

    (a)    By guideline, the Department shall establish a system, sufficient for the purposes of subsections (b) and (c) of this section, to collect data from the local health officers, from public and private health care providers, and from parents on the incidence of pertussis and major adverse reactions to pertussis vaccine.

    (b)    On the basis of information collected under this subsection and of other information available, the Department shall periodically revise and update the information required by § 18–329 of this subtitle and the guidelines adopted under § 18–332 of this subtitle.

    (c)    The Department shall report to the United States Centers for Disease Control and Prevention all information collected under subsection (a) of this section, including that received under § 18–330(b) of this subtitle.
